在广州待了十几年,我最怕听到的一句话就是:“我电脑里的数据没了。”尤其是做生意的朋友,数据库崩了,那简直比丢了钱包还让人崩溃。前几天一个做跨境电商的老哥半夜打电话来,声音都在抖,说他公司那个存着三年客户订单、供应商信息的SQL Server数据库,突然就打不开了。我一边安抚他,一边心里清楚,这事儿在广州太常见了。这座城市到处都是创业公司、小工厂、贸易商行,大家忙着赚钱,没几个人会提前给数据库做好备份。等到数据真丢了,才急得满世界找“数据库恢复”的公司,像热锅上的蚂蚁。

广州的数据库恢复需求,跟这座城市的气质特别像——急、乱、杂。你想想,从十三行服装批发市场的档口,到天河软件园的科技公司,再到番禺的工厂,每个人用的数据库都不一样。有人还在用FoxPro这种古董级系统,有人已经上了Oracle,但大部分中小公司用的都是SQL Server或者MySQL。这些数据库出问题,原因五花八门:硬盘坏了、误删数据、病毒攻击、系统崩溃,甚至有人手贱把表给删了。最惨的是那些小老板,数据库文件损坏了,找了好几家“数据恢复”店,结果对方要么说修不了,要么报价贵得离谱,才辗转找到专业做数据库恢复的团队。
说到专业数据库恢复,这行水很深。广州有不少电脑维修店,门口挂着“数据恢复”的牌子,但他们的手艺多半停留在“硬盘开盘”或者“U盘恢复”的层面。遇到数据库文件损坏,他们通常就是拿个软件跑一遍,能扫出数据就收钱,扫不出来就推说“物理损坏严重”。真正专业的数据库恢复,远没这么简单。它需要对数据库底层存储结构、文件格式有深入理解,像SQL Server的MDF文件、Oracle的DBF文件,损坏后怎么修复,是个技术活。我认识一个广州做这行的老师傅,他说他每年经手的案例里,有一半都是被其他店修过一遍、修坏了才送到他手里的。
数据库恢复最大的难点,在于“不可逆”。一旦操作失误,数据可能永远找不回来。比如有个做外贸的公司,MySQL数据库里的InnoDB表空间文件损坏了,他们自己上网找了个“修复工具”一通操作,结果把文件头信息彻底搞乱了。后来送到专业团队手里,花了三天三夜才从日志里拼回一部分数据,最终还是损失了将近一个月的订单记录。这让我想起一个比喻:数据库就像一本精装字典,每页都标着页码,如果页码乱了,你还能根据内容大概猜出是哪一页;但如果有人把页码涂掉、把纸撕碎,再想复原就难了。所以,遇到数据库问题,第一反应千万别是“试试看”,而是“找对人”。
在广州,真正靠谱的数据库恢复团队,通常不会满大街打广告。他们多半藏身在一些科技园区、写字楼里,靠口碑和案例吃饭。他们的工作流程也很有讲究:第一步永远是“只读镜像”,也就是说,先给损坏的数据库文件做个完整的副本,然后在副本上操作,绝不碰原始文件。这样即使修复过程出了问题,原始数据也完好无损。第二步才是诊断分析,判断是逻辑损坏还是物理损坏,是页级错误还是元数据损坏。第三步才是修复,有时候需要手动编辑二进制数据,有时候要重建索引,甚至要从数据库的事务日志里一点点提取未提交的数据。
说起来,广州的数据库恢复市场,其实反映了一个更深层的问题:很多企业缺乏数据安全意识。我见过最典型的案例,是一家做了八年生意的服装厂,所有客户资料、库存数据、财务记录都存在一个Access数据库里,连个备份都没有。某天U盘中毒,数据库文件打不开了,老板急得差点报警。花了两万多块才把数据找回来,其中一半的钱是加急费。事后我问他,为什么不买个NAS或者用云数据库?他说:“以前没想过,觉得不会出事。”这话听起来耳熟吧?很多广州老板都是这样的思维,总觉得数据出问题是小概率事件,真摊上了才后悔。
但话说回来,广州这座城市也有它的韧性。数据库恢复这个行当,之所以能在这座城市生存下来,就是因为有大量真实的需求。每天都有新的创业公司成立,每天都有旧的数据系统在老化、在崩溃。我认识的一个数据恢复工程师,他办公室里挂着一幅字:“数据无价,信任如山。”他说,每次接到客户的电话,听到对方声音里那种绝望和焦急,心里都不是滋味。毕竟,对于一个小老板来说,数据库里存着的可能不只是数据,而是他几年的心血、一家人的生计。
所以,如果你在广州,手头有重要的数据库,我建议你花点时间做好两件事:一是定期备份,二是找一家靠谱的数据库恢复服务商,把联系方式存好。备份是你的保险,而专业的数据库恢复团队,是你的救生圈。别等到数据真的丢了,才想起来去找他们——那时候,每一分钟都是钱,每一秒都可能意味着客户流失。广州这地方,机会多,竞争也激烈,数据就是你手里的武器,千万别让它变成你崩溃的理由。


